    Quote Originally Posted by gmoney View Post
    best zipper grease in the world is chapstick. does wonders for anything with a zipper thats on your boat.
    Works great on snaps too.... just be careful, my buddy used it on the snaps on his enclosure and whenever he got up on plane..... the snaps on the canvas would come undone....

    after getting hit in the face with his eisenglass a few times.... we wiped them off with acetone to get the lube off.
